Buying a courier and last-mile delivery business?
Local and regional delivery operations that move parcels, medical specimens, legal documents, and e-commerce orders the final stretch to homes and businesses, often under contract with healthcare systems, pharmacies, and national shippers. Contracted routes produce steady, repeatable revenue, and the customer relationships tend to transfer cleanly with the business, though contract terms and driver classification deserve close review before closing.
